2024-04-18T02:10:57Z - 2024-10-18T02:10:57Z
Overview
There has not been any commit activity in this period.
106 issues closed from 16 users
Closed
#976 [Ansible] - Style convention
Closed
#1013 [FEDisroot] · SPAM flood
Closed
#999 [LibreTranslate] - Numpy version downgrade needed?
Closed
#1016 typo in xmpp abuse contact info
Closed
#916 [Etesync] - Production deployment
Closed
#919 [Etesync] - Public testing
Closed
#983 [Jitsi] - Test and fix if needed.
Closed
#918 [Etesync] - Private testing
Closed
#969 [Prosody]- New mods for moderation?
Closed
#760 [NEXTCLOUD] • [COLLECTIVES APP] Feature request
Closed
#963 Write new Blog post
Closed
#718 [cstate pusher] - Fix date and xmpp posting
Closed
#799 [Roundcube] - Add TLS icon plugin
Closed
#930 [CT] - Upgrade all php services to 8.2
Closed
#1005 XMPP down
Closed
#953 [Etherpad] - Broken time slider
Closed
#996 [Support] - Since zammad supports pgp there is no need to keep cryptsupport address as seperate one
Closed
#940 [New Auth] - (staging) Add Keycloak to email
Closed
#965 [CT] - Fix mail container situation with ip
Closed
#995 [Custom Domain] Broken link in welcome email
Closed
#975 Check and merge or close all PR :)
Closed
#955 [Cryptpad] - Pads not removed after account deleted?
Closed
#974 Check and test Invoice Ninja
Closed
#981 [Lacre] - Setup in production
Closed
#985 [Lacre] - Update and test ansible role
Closed
#943 [New Auth] - (Staging) Test 2FA/FIDO
Closed
#808 [Staging] - Improve the participation in deployments of all Core members (phase1)
Closed
#936 [New Auth] - (Staging) Sync with LDAP
Closed
#937 [New Auth] - (Staging) Add keycloak to forgejo
Closed
#980 [Lacre]- Setup lacre on staging
Closed
#987 [Lacre] - Test Lacre
Closed
#890 [Email] - Re-implement spamassasing learning on spam.report
Closed
#979 [Staging] - Fixup test mailserver
Closed
#984 [CRYPTPAD] 404 - Down.
Closed
#954 Disroot Git .onion domain not working
Closed
#970 Should we remove nginx_default_vhost_ssl in nginx role?
Closed
#856 Add node role in needed playbooks
Closed
#909 Nextcloud file sync broken
Closed
#816 [Beet Themes] - Separate all custom changes in themes from upstream
Closed
#907 [CT] - Make sure all container scripts are properly deployed
Closed
#972 [Nginx] - Shouldn't ssl_src_path be remplaced by nginx_ssl_dir in ssl.yml task
Closed
#967 [php-fpm] - Cleanup unused php versions
Closed
#971 Prosody and letsencrypt clean up
Closed
#961 [Webmail] - Spellcheck plugin
Closed
#935 [New Auth] - Deploy Keycloak on staging server
Closed
#924 [CT] - Implement new Letsencrypt cert distribution
Closed
#968 Home cleaning: check questions and comments
Closed
#898 [CT] - Make sure all containers are properly backed up weekly
Closed
#964 Remove discourse and discoursedb CT
Closed
#951 [Etesync] - No Account Dashboard
Closed
#959 [XMPP] - Add xmpp-provider-v2.json to prosody
Closed
#956 [Prosody] - Broken contact info
Closed
#920 [Forgejo] - Ansible role improve install/upgrade task
Closed
#899 [CT] - Improve logrotate
Closed
#903 [CT] - Cron run cron playbook on all containers
Closed
#926 [CT] - Add operation playbook
Closed
#960 [Website] - Broken Forms
Closed
#950 Update bookworm template to fix apt
Closed
#948 External Apps Login fails for D-Scribe
Closed
#952 I haven't received any emails from Amazon.co.jp
Closed
#893 [Website] Layout of language selector: implement new template
Closed
#654 [New Auth] - Check candidate: Zitadel
Closed
#655 [New Auth] - Check candidate: Canaille
Closed
#673 [New Auth] - Check candidate: LemonLDAP
Closed
#653 [New Auth] - Check candidate: Keycloak
Closed
#815 [New Auth] - Create list of options for new authentication system.
Closed
#860 NC shared folders broken after server migration
Closed
#887 [Forgejo] - theme tweak
Closed
#889 [Git] - Implement new authentication
Closed
#905 [blog] fix blog page
Closed
#902 [Lacre] - Update ansible role
Closed
#904 [FORGEJO] Theming - Notification Icon Tweak
Closed
#865 [Howto] - Draft new theme concept
Closed
#845 Deploy test instance for EteSync
Closed
#847 Deploy Peertube instance
Closed
#910 [Pulga] - Reinstall server and migrate containers
Closed
#746 [Nextcloud] - Cannot decrypt this file, probably this is a shared file. Please ask the file owner to reshare the file with you
Closed
#765 alias dead link welcome mail
Closed
#906 [Base CT] - Add possibility to change apt mirror
Closed
#895 [Lemmy] Unable to attch images.
Closed
#846 [Jitsi] - Fix video bridge
Closed
#894 [Forgejo] - Add all the custom themes we pull to the list
Closed
#892 HTML <title> suffix is now 'Disroot.lan' instead of just 'Disroot'
Closed
#863 [Website] – Dead(?) web page https://devchat.disroot.org/
Closed
#888 [Website] - RSS feed broken
Closed
#886 [Forgejo] - time tracker forgejo
Closed
#876 Fix implementation of user data wipe
Closed
#840 [New site] - Setup staging and dev site
Closed
#885 Concerns about the developers of Lemmy
Closed
#875 etherpad over Tor broken on pad.disroot.org/?
Closed
#882 A redirect to a dead LibreTranslate page
Closed
#877 Update proxy ansible vars
Closed
#881 [AKKOMA] Uploaded Images Do Not Appear.
Closed
#884 Update to Forgejo 7?
Closed
#869 [Staging] - Setup Grav sites
Closed
#807 [Staging] - Implement new Deployment procedure for 1st phase services
Closed
#712 [Movim] - Fix issue with not seeing own omemo messages in private muc
Closed
#862 [AKKOMA] · [FEDisroot Basic Coexistence Guidelines proposal]
Closed
#688 [Libretranslate] - Frontend language doesn't change
Closed
#874 update monal link
Closed
#810 [Staging] - Setup 3rd phase of services
Closed
#809 [Staging] - Setup 2nd phase of services
Closed
#878 Wrong DNS alias?
Closed
#801 Current state of status.disroot.org
Closed
#870 [Status page] - Update disroot android app before switching to kuma
Closed
#842 [New site] - Check for outdate/incomplete content
78 issues created by 15 users
Opened
#872 [SCRIBE] Federation Appears To Be Offline
Opened
#873 The maintenance page doesn't look good on small screens
Opened
#879 [Akkoma] Akkoma doesn't follow redirects
Opened
#880 Currently jitsi role is broken
Opened
#883 (Idea) Send Annual Security Reminder Emails
Opened
#891 [Grav] - Fix the permissions on the role
Opened
#896 [CT] - make sure monitoring Alerts properly on low res
Opened
#897 [DB] - Make sure all db_backup is managed by ansible
Opened
#900 [POSTGRES] - Upgrade all db to postgres 15
Opened
#901 [Mariadb] - Upgrade to 11.04 (or 10.11)
Opened
#908 [PROPOSAL] Few new secure services\features to Disroot
Opened
#911 [Etesync] - Disrootify frontend
Opened
#912 [Etesync] - User creation
Opened
#913 [New service] - Etesync
Opened
#914 [Etesync] - Create Service page
Opened
#915 [Etesync] - Create tutorials
Opened
#917 [Etesync] - Update privacy policy
Opened
#921 [Howto] - Install Learn2 theme on test
Opened
#922 [Howto] - Apply disroot color scheme for the theme
Opened
#923 [Howto] - Add Disroot site menu
Opened
#925 [CT] - Auto deploy containers
Opened
#927 [CT] - Upgrade remaining containers to bookworm.
Opened
#931 [CT] - Verify all service data is backed up
Opened
#932 [CT Scripts] - Rewrite db backup to report to zabbix
Opened
#933 [CT Scripts] - Rewrite borgbackup to report to zabbix
Opened
#934 Disroot SearXNG Cookies broken
Opened
#938 [New Auth] - Staging add keycloak to nextcloud
Opened
#939 [New Auth] - (Staging) Add keycloak to xmpp
Opened
#941 [New Auth] - (Staging) Add Keycloak to Akkoma
Opened
#942 [New Auth] - (Staging) Create Registration page
Opened
#944 [New Auth] - (Staging) User administration
Opened
#945 [New Auth] - (Staging) Self service center
Opened
#946 [New Auth] - Investigate custom admin scenarios and create needed tickets
Opened
#947 [New Auth] - (Staging) Test backup/restore user db
Opened
#949 [Forgejo] - JavaScript error on Milestones
Opened
#957 [PROPOSAL] Signing Documents and VPN with PQ-algoritms (free\payment?) on Disroot
Opened
#958 [ct] - Improve container template distribution
Opened
#962 [Proxy] - Manage static pages with ansible
Opened
#966 Add support for the new JMAP email protocol
Opened
#973 [Ara] - Update role to install ara with pip instead of debian package
Opened
#977 [tor] add capability for transmitting email to onion recipients
Opened
#978 My connection to disroot.org XMPP server often drops
Opened
#982 Mailing lists
Opened
#986 [Lacre] - Re-deploy on lacre.io
Opened
#988 User feedback form
Opened
#989 [Invoice ninja] - List what we need to do for new accounting instance
Opened
#990 [Finances] Drop Patreon as donation option
Opened
#991 [New site] - Home page
Opened
#992 [New site] - About page
Opened
#993 [New site] - Email page
Opened
#994 [New site] - Contact page
Opened
#997 [Backup] - Cleanup and update our backup server
Opened
#998 Add new service vaultwarden
Opened
#1000 [Execute] - Git organization change
Opened
#1001 [New Auth] - app password
Opened
#1002 [New Auth] - Add Keycloak to Lemmy
Opened
#1003 [New Auth] - Add Keycloak to Roundcube
Opened
#1004 [New Auth] - Test oauth on Fairemail
Opened
#1006 [New Auth] - Allow users to disable legacy mail/xmpp clients
Opened
#1007 [Lemmy] Failure to upload images.
Opened
#1008 [Proposal] E-mail Aliaces, Temporary Image hosting and mirror in I2P net?
Opened
#1009 [Etesync] - Implement on prod
Opened
#1010 Donation message
Opened
#1011 [Email] - Enable DSN
Opened
#1012 [Forgejo] - Add ssh fingerprint to webiste service page
Opened
#1014 [Webmail] - Cannot login after changing password
Opened
#1015 [Mail] - Evolution fails DKIM check
Opened
#1017 [Etesync] - Logo
Opened
#1018 Cloud bookmarks not working
Opened
#1019 [InvoiceNinja] - Find minimum donation - coffee cup
Opened
#1020 [InvoiceNinja] - Find out if we can do crypto payments via invoice ninja
Opened
#1021 [InvoiceNinja] - Test linking to the bank to be able to see all transactions
Opened
#1022 [InvoiceNinja] - Update website donation page
Opened
#1023 [InvoiceNinja] - Email those that do donation through bank transfer
Opened
#1024 [InvoiceNinja] - Recreate all needed recurring invoices
Opened
#1025 [InvoiceNinja] - Update documentation about the procedures
Opened
#1026 Cryptpad Survey: public link access denied
Opened
#1027 [XMPP] - problems connecting with poddery.com
27 unresolved conversations
Open
#817
[Beet Themes] - Create Unified theme guideline
Open
#759
[XMPP] · [MOVIM] Can't establish connection while trying to video call between instance's users
Open
#812
[Staging] - Implement monitoring
Open
#813
[Staging] - Improve production automation
Open
#829
[Merch] - Design drafts prints
Open
#830
[Merch] - Price
Open
#625
[Searx] - Dashboard via Onion should point to onion addresses
Open
#841
[New site] - Implement new theme
Open
#566
[Tor] - Provide onion address for smtp/imap/pop3
Open
#148
Seek for community maintainers
Open
#861
Unified push for Nextcloud
Open
#411
[Nextcloud] - Update the role and use it in prod
Open
#465
[Nextcloud] - Test collabora with new server?
Open
#648
[Nextcloud] - Test e2e
Open
#731
[Pleroma] - Add custom emojis
Open
#790
[Akkoma] - Enable AkkomaFE
Open
#848
User.disroot.org login takes very long
Open
#836
[Merch] - Production of items
Open
#331
Add IPv6 Support
Open
#457
Account username not populating in Nextcloud Dashboard
Open
#770
[Prosody] serve xmpp over 443 port
Open
#858
[PROPOSAL] Secure second-bottom for e-mail (and more)
Open
#871
[Prosody] - channel binding doesn't work
Open
#866
[Howto] - Change/Update file structure of the tutorials
Open
#570
[TOR] - Test cryptpad over tor
Open
#108
[New site] - Global html error code pages
Open
#834
[Merch] - Decide on pre-order merch campaign